★ - sad headcanon; ☠ - angry/violent headcanon; ∇ -. old age/aging headcanon; ൠ - random headcanon all for Eko!
★ - Two words: walking depression. There comes a certain point that everything that hurts, doesn’t really hurt anymore because you’ve ignored them for so long. Eko reached that point a long time ago. “It’s Oookay. I’m always Oookay.”
☠ - It’s not easy to piss Eko off. Because everything is okay. She can even beat the crap out of someone without meaning it in an overly malicious way. But if someone were to seriously hurt someone dear to her, they would feel the wrath behind the (unsettling) smile.
∇ - In the dominant timelines, Eko doesn’t age. This is because she either learns to control her psychics and project her world-building (which is a place devoid of time or space) or she is attached to a machine that controls it for her. She’ll be immortal until she decides not to be.
ൠ - She’s really good about knowing where to look when her eyes are closed and she’s conversating with someone. Unless she’s inside an area where the sound bounces around more. Her cave-hive, for instance, is not ideal for such things. (I always picture her turning in circles and looking around, trying to figure out where to look while Malium talks and walks around her in circles to try and speak to her face to face. It’s a never-ending cycle of hilarity and cuteness.)
